Understanding the Immune System
The immune system is a highly coordinated network that monitors, responds, and adapts to internal and external influences. It is broadly supported by two interconnected systems.
Innate Immunity
The body's immediate line of defence. This includes physical barriers such as the skin, respiratory tract, and digestive lining, along with fast-acting immune cells that respond quickly to environmental exposures and everyday stressors.
Adaptive Immunity
A more specialised system that develops over time. Adaptive immunity "learns" from past exposures and supports more targeted responses, contributing to efficient recovery and long-term resilience.
Together, these systems help maintain internal balance, support healthy inflammation responses, and contribute to overall vitality.

Foundational Habits That Support Immune Health
Consistent daily habits form the foundation of long-term immune resilience.
Restorative Sleep
Sleep is essential for immune regulation and recovery. During sleep, the body supports repair processes, moderates inflammation, and restores energy reserves. Establishing consistent sleep routines may help promote deeper, more restorative rest.
Nourishing Nutrition
A balanced diet rich in whole foods provides essential nutrient required for immune function. Vegetables, fruits, whole grains, healthy fats, and quality protein sources contribute to overall nutritional adequacy and cellular health.
Hydration
Adequate hydration supports circulation, nutrient transport, and the maintenance of healthy mucous membranes.
Stress Management
Chronic stress may influence immune function. Practices such as mindfulness, time in nature, and gentle movement may help support a more balanced stress response.
Regular Movement
Physical activity supports circulation, lymphatic flow, and overall vitality, Consistent, moderate movement is often more beneficial than irregular intensity.

Herbal & Nutritional Support for Immune Health
Traditional herbal medicine and targeted nutrients have long been used to support immune function and overall wellbeing.
Echinacea
Traditionally used in Western herbal medicine to support immune system function and help relieve symptoms of the common cold.
Astragalus
Traditionally used in Chinese medicine to support immune health and promote vitality.
Cat's Claw
Traditionally used to promote immune defence and stimulate a healthy immune system response.
B Vitamins
Support energy production, nervous system health, and the body's response to stress, all of which play a role in immune function.
Golden Seal
Traditionally used in Western herbal medicine to support mucous membrane health and relieve mild upper respiratory tract congestion.
Andrographis
Traditionally used to help relieve symptoms of the common cold and support healthy immune function.
